Output 8955d7c37096d0b1f5b3129fb6dc10e397b0435f894ab083fdaffc06831f0d3c:2

value
43067530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2630258a43345e61f851bf0824e66a7d1fd2817 OP_EQUAL
address
MRcyvvU9XoS2jbufdph4LudfEasDHnDh7X
transaction
8955d7c37096d0b1f5b3129fb6dc10e397b0435f894ab083fdaffc06831f0d3c
spent
true